The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I) party protested Imran Khan's detention on Saturday, claiming that his arrest by Pakistan's military administration, led by General Asim Munir, violates the United Nations' Nelson Mandela Rules for the Treatment of Prisoners.

Imran Khan's initial arrest by the Pakistani Rangers on May 9, 2023, sparked significant protests across the country. He was detained on Islamabad High Court grounds as part of a National Accountability Bureau (NAB) investigation into the Al-Qadir Trust issue, reported ANI.
